一种计算机数据采集处理分析系统的制作方法
【技术领域】
[0001]本发明涉及数据分析领域,具体涉及一种计算机数据采集处理分析系统。
【背景技术】
[0002]当进行数据分析时,经常面对一类业务需要多种分析方法的情况,然而目前的解决方案均是采用一类业务制作多张报表来满足多种分析需求,从而造成复杂度的提高并且带来较多的重复工作。
【发明内容】
[0003]为解决上述问题,本发明提供了一种计算机数据采集处理分析系统,可以降低分析的复杂度,减少了数据分析时的工作量,且可以满足各种不同的分析需求,分析结果更加直观。
[0004]为实现上述目的,本发明采取的技术方案为:
[0005]—种计算机数据采集处理分析系统,包括
[0006]多模式数据采集模块,包括图片数据采集模块、语音数据采集模块和文字数据采集模块,用于采集待分析计算机的相关数据,并将数据发送到数据处理模块;
[0007]人机操作模块,用于输入各种分析要求以及信息调用命令;
[0008]数据处理模块,用于接收输入的图片数据、文字数据和语音数据,去除图像中的斑点噪声,提取图片中的特征值,并将特征值转换成文本数据发送到中央处理器;提取文字数据中的关键字发送到中央处理器;将语音数据转换成文本数据,并提取关键字发送到中央处理器;
[0009]中央处理器,用于接收数据处理模块的数据,并将其转换成物理模型建立模块所能识别的数据格式发送到物理模型建立模块;并根据人机操作模块所输入的信息调用命令,调用相应的数据并发送到显示屏进行显示;
[0010]物理模型建立模块,用于接收中央处理器发送的数据,并根据接收到的数据建立物理模块;
[0011]动态硬点表构建模块,用于通过Matlab读取物理模型中各硬点的坐标数值,从而形成一个动态硬点表;
[0012]参数化模型构建模块,用于根据硬点表建立待分析数据的参数化模型;
[0013]虚拟作动器,用于驱动参数变化的,与参数化模型中的各元素建立关系后,可以在指定的范围内对参数进行变动,从而可以驱动分析方法针对不同的参数进行计算求解;
[0014]虚拟传感器,用于在参数化模型中插入各类型的可直接获取相应的结果或信息的目标的逻辑单元;
[0015]分析方法数据库,用于储存各类分析算法。
[0016]优选地,所述虚拟传感器包括通用虚拟传感器和专用虚拟传感器。
[0017]优选地,所述虚拟作动器包括虚拟单元作动器、虚拟特性作动器和虚拟载荷作动器。
[0018]优选地,还包括一更新模块,更新模块内设有一定时模块,用于实时更新分析算法数据库内的数据。
[0019]优选地,还包括一数据库,用于储存输入的各种数据以及其对应的分析结果。
[0020]其中,所述硬点为物理模型中的各个连接点。
[0021]本发明具有以下有益效果:
[0022]可以降低分析的复杂度,减少了数据分析时的工作量,且可以满足各种不同的分析需求,分析结果更加直观。
【附图说明】
[0023]图1为本发明实施例一种计算机数据采集处理分析系统的系统框图。
【具体实施方式】
[0024]为了使本发明的目的及优点更加清楚明白,以下结合实施例对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。
[0025]如图1所示,本发明实施例提供了一种计算机数据采集处理分析系统,包括
[0026]多模式数据采集模块,包括图片数据采集模块、语音数据采集模块和文字数据采集模块,用于采集待分析计算机的相关数据,并将数据发送到数据处理模块;
[0027]人机操作模块,用于输入各种分析要求以及信息调用命令;
[0028]数据处理模块,用于接收输入的图片数据、文字数据和语音数据,去除图像中的斑点噪声,提取图片中的特征值,并将特征值转换成文本数据发送到中央处理器;提取文字数据中的关键字发送到中央处理器;将语音数据转换成文本数据,并提取关键字发送到中央处理器;
[0029]中央处理器,用于接收数据处理模块的数据,并将其转换成物理模型建立模块所能识别的数据格式发送到物理模型建立模块;并根据人机操作模块所输入的信息调用命令,调用相应的数据并发送到显示屏进行显示;
[0030]物理模型建立模块,用于接收中央处理器发送的数据,并根据接收到的数据建立物理模块;
[0031]动态硬点表构建模块,用于通过Matlab读取物理模型中各硬点的坐标数值,从而形成一个动态硬点表;
[0032]参数化模型构建模块,用于根据硬点表建立待分析数据的参数化模型;
[0033]虚拟作动器,用于驱动参数变化的,与参数化模型中的各元素建立关系后,可以在指定的范围内对参数进行变动,从而可以驱动分析方法针对不同的参数进行计算求解;
[0034]虚拟传感器,用于在参数化模型中插入各类型的可直接获取相应的结果或信息的目标的逻辑单元;
[0035]分析方法数据库,用于储存各类分析算法。
[0036]所述虚拟传感器包括通用虚拟传感器和专用虚拟传感器。
[0037]所述虚拟作动器包括虚拟单元作动器、虚拟特性作动器和虚拟载荷作动器。
[0038]还包括一更新模块,更新模块内设有一定时模块,用于实时更新分析算法数据库内的数据。
[0039]还包括一数据库,用于储存输入的各种数据以及其对应的分析结果。
[0040]本具体实施包括如下步骤:
[0041]S1、通过多模式数据采集模块进行待分析数据的采集,根据输入的分析需求以及采集到数据构建物理模型;
[0042]S2、通过Matlab读取物理模型中各硬点的坐标数值,形成一个动态硬点表,硬点表中包括各硬点坐标名称,以及每一硬点对应的坐标数值;
[0043]S3、根据硬点表,建立一硬点构造模型,并对所得硬点构造模型进行参数化处理,使硬点构造模型与硬点表建立关联,并发布硬点构造模型中已关联的各硬点;
[0044]S4、在硬点构造模型中布置若干虚拟作动器和虚拟传感器,并通过虚拟作动器和虚拟传感器进行算法的输入;
[0045]S5、得出分析结果。
[0046]所述动态硬点表通过以下步骤建立:
[0047 ] 使用Mat I ab读取所述ADAMS硬点文件中各硬点的坐标数值导入一EXCEL文件中,在所述EXCEL文件的第一表单中存放有所述各硬点名称、坐标数值以及相邻两个坐标之间的距离;在所述EXCEL文件的第二表单的第一列放置硬点坐标名称,第二列链接到第一表单中相应的坐标数值,所述EXCEL文件即为所述可修改的硬点表。
[0048]以上仅是本发明的优选实施方式,应当指出,对于本技术领域的普通技术人员来说,在不脱离本发明原理的前提下,还可以作出若干改进和润饰,这些改进和润饰也应视为本发明的保护范围。
【主权项】
1.一种计算机数据采集处理分析系统,其特征在于,包括 多模式数据采集模块,包括图片数据采集模块、语音数据采集模块和文字数据采集模块,用于采集待分析计算机的相关数据,并将数据发送到数据处理模块; 人机操作模块,用于输入各种分析要求以及信息调用命令; 数据处理模块,用于接收输入的图片数据、文字数据和语音数据,去除图像中的斑点噪声,提取图片中的特征值,并将特征值转换成文本数据发送到中央处理器;提取文字数据中的关键字发送到中央处理器;将语音数据转换成文本数据,并提取关键字发送到中央处理器; 中央处理器,用于接收数据处理模块的数据,并将其转换成物理模型建立模块所能识别的数据格式发送到物理模型建立模块;并根据人机操作模块所输入的信息调用命令,调用相应的数据并发送到显示屏进行显示; 物理模型建立模块,用于接收中央处理器发送的数据,并根据接收到的数据建立物理模块; 动态硬点表构建模块,用于通过Matlab读取物理模型中各硬点的坐标数值,从而形成一个动态硬点表; 参数化模型构建模块,用于根据硬点表建立待分析数据的参数化模型; 虚拟作动器,用于驱动参数变化的,与参数化模型中的各元素建立关系后,可以在指定的范围内对参数进行变动,从而可以驱动分析方法针对不同的参数进行计算求解; 虚拟传感器,用于在参数化模型中插入各类型的可直接获取相应的结果或信息的目标的逻辑单元; 分析方法数据库,用于储存各类分析算法。2.根据权利要求1所述的一种计算机数据采集处理分析系统,其特征在于,所述虚拟传感器包括通用虚拟传感器和专用虚拟传感器。3.根据权利要求1所述的一种计算机数据采集处理分析系统,其特征在于,所述虚拟作动器包括虚拟单元作动器、虚拟特性作动器和虚拟载荷作动器。4.根据权利要求1所述的一种计算机数据采集处理分析系统,其特征在于,还包括一更新模块,更新模块内设有一定时模块,用于实时更新分析算法数据库内的数据。5.根据权利要求1所述的一种计算机数据采集处理分析系统,其特征在于,还包括一数据库,用于储存输入的各种数据以及其对应的分析结果。
【专利摘要】本发明公开了一种计算机数据采集处理分析系统,包括多模式数据采集模块,人机操作模块,用于输入各种分析要求以及信息调用命令;数据处理模块,中央处理器,物理模型建立模块,动态硬点表构建模块,参数化模型构建模块,虚拟作动器,虚拟传感器和分析方法数据库。本发明可以降低分析的复杂度,减少了数据分析时的工作量,且可以满足各种不同的分析需求,分析结果更加直观。
【IPC分类】G06F17/24, G06F17/30
【公开号】CN105677716
【申请号】CN201511009496
【发明人】蔡春华, 蔡昊
【申请人】牡丹江师范学院
【公开日】2016年6月15日
【申请日】2015年12月23日